Understanding the Ford Kuga MK3 Washer Jets System
The washer jets system in the Ford Kuga MK3 is designed to provide a clear view of the road ahead, even in heavy rain or snow. The system consists of a reservoir that stores a mixture of water and washer fluid, which is then sprayed onto the windshield, windows, and mirrors through a network of jets and nozzles. The washer jets are typically located at the front and rear of the vehicle, and they are connected to the reservoir by a series of hoses. The Ford Kuga MK3 washer jets are designed to provide a consistent and effective cleaning of the windshield and other exterior glass surfaces. However, like any mechanical component, they can be prone to certain issues. One of the most common problems is clogged washer jets, which can be caused by debris, dirt, or other contaminants in the washer fluid. This can lead to poor cleaning performance, streaks, and even damage to the windshield wiper blades.
To avoid clogged washer jets, it's essential to regularly check and clean the washer nozzles. This can be done by soaking the nozzles in a mixture of water and vinegar, then rinsing them thoroughly with clean water. You can also use a specialized washer nozzle cleaning tool to remove any stubborn debris.
